Output 95dbb9e13fe7c6d1ae641116ce01d4bfeaa4bd27c27cab96a17794a8babf81af:31

value
1580000
script pubkey
OP_0 OP_PUSHBYTES_20 15bdfa18ffd83b625f43d1dd9d30a78c89342b0d
address
bc1qzk7l5x8lmqakyh6r68we6v983jyng2cdpmkn7m
transaction
95dbb9e13fe7c6d1ae641116ce01d4bfeaa4bd27c27cab96a17794a8babf81af